  • Midget - A social is a big party where people buy tickets, we have a cash bar (all proceeds to us) and silent auction. It is a fundraiser for the wedding. We are using ours for our HM. Socials are huge in my province, in my circle you HAVE to have one lol, people look forward to them more than the wedding. It is also for those people to come who won't be coming to the wedding.

    I will say that it TOTALLY depends on your DJ as to whether things are "hit or miss."  A really good DJ will be able to read your crowd and play appropriate music to make sure they're having a good time.  You also typically have the advantage of a much larger library of music, plus most DJs (at least ones around here) are willing to buy & play songs and even specific renditions of songs that you like.

    A band can create a more intimate atmosphere, but it does depend on your guests and what they like.  They also have a far more limited repertoire when it comes to what they are able and willing to play.  One thing to consider is that bands do occasionally make mistakes with the songs they play - some people consider this a good thing, as it gives a human quality to the music being played, while others really prefer a "flawless" performance of the music they like!
